Introduction
AI is changing both the systems we build and the way we conduct research and engineering. Within IBM Research AI Native Systems, our mission is to position IBM at the forefront of enterprise AI deployment while transforming how future systems are designed and built.
The AI-Native Hardware-Software Co-design Methodologies organization brings hardware and software together through a continuous co-design loop. Our research portfolio spans AI-assisted compiler development, kernel generation and optimization, RTL generation, hardware implementation, verification, and cross-layer system optimization. We also investigate reinforcement learning and other post-training techniques that can extend open models to solve increasingly difficult hardware and software engineering problems.
Interns join focused projects within this broader research portfolio based on their experience and interests. By connecting insights across teams and technical layers, we aim to shorten development cycles, improve end-to-end system performance and efficiency, and uncover optimization opportunities that may be missed when hardware and software are developed independently.
This internship offers the opportunity to work with a multidisciplinary research team, contribute to emerging AI-native engineering methods, and explore ideas that can shape future IBM systems and the broader computing ecosystem.
